Intussusception in adults is a rare condition and it can occur as a gastric complication from non-Hodgkin's lymphoma. Such complications can be difficult to diagnose because of ill-defined symptoms. Methods of imaging such as abdominal X-rays, ultrasonography, tomography and colonoscopy are useful for its diagnosis. Here a female patient with non-Hodgkin's lymphoma that evolved to intussusception of bowels, the regression of which was achieved by clinical and chemotherapeutic treatment without surgical intervention.
